Using the internet use data file above, work collaboratively to accomplish the following tasks:
FORMAT THE SPREADSHEET
- Remove the Average Monthly Disposable Salary data from column I and insert it into column F (shift existing columns to the right)
- Make the formatting to the header row the same as the Monthly Disposable Salary (use format painter)
- Match the formatting of the data in the Monthly Disposable Salary column the same as the rest of the data
- Calculate population density for each country/region
- Calculate Internet Penetration. Use an if statement so that if the Internet Users value is n/a, the Internet Penetration data is also n/a. Alter the format of the cell so that it automatically displays as a percentage to 2 decimal places
- Find the average for all columns and place that below the data (line 274)
- Adjust the scaling of the worksheet, (1 sheet wide by 5 sheets long), so that it could print legibly. DO NOT PRINT – this will be checked digitally
- Sort and filter the data to explore
- Notice patterns and/or trends in the data
- Develop 5 questions you can “ask” of this data
- Extract information to display “answers” to your 5 questions
- Create visualizations (charts/graphs) for each of your 5 questions
